About Lucky Bums Tracker II 25 Backpack (For Kids)
Closeouts. From the bus stop to the campsite, the Lucky Bums Tracker II 25 backpack has all the room your young explorer needs. It'll accommodate books and gym clothes during the week, and an extra jacket and a lunch on the weekend thanks to a large main compartment and a myriad zip pockets -- just like mom's or dad's pack!
- Polyurethane-coated polyester is durable and lightweight
- Internal composite frame helps pack retain its shape
- Zip main compartment features slide-in pocket
- Zip secondary pocket
- Mesh exterior water bottle holders
- Padded, moisture-wicking shoulder straps
- Breathable mesh back panels
- Buckle sternum strap with safety whistle
- Buckle waistbelt
- Imported
Specs
Specs about Lucky Bums Tracker II 25 Backpack (For Kids)
- Pack material: Polyester with polyurethane coating
- Frame type: Internal
- Frame material: Composite framesheet
- Pack loading: Top
- Recommended use: Daypack
- Dimensions: 18x11x7"
- Volume liters: 25L
- Weight: 1 lb. 7.9 oz.
- Imported
